About CF10 1AX
CF10 1AX scores 91/100 on the NestScope Score, with its strongest showing in schools and transport — with St Mary The Virgin C.I.W. Primary School about 11 minutes' walk away. The breakdown below draws on official UK data covering schools, safety, healthcare, transport, environment and local amenities.
CF10 1AX sits outside England, so the national deprivation backbone (IMD) that anchors the NestScope Score isn't available — the figures below are based on local amenities only.
There are 41 schools within the typical catchment area. The nearest school is St Mary The Virgin C.I.W. Primary School, about 11 minutes' walk away.
Healthcare access is good, with 31 GP surgeries and 15 dental practices in the wider neighbourhood. The nearest GP practice is BRO TAF DEPUTY, about 6 minutes' walk away. A pharmacy is about 3 minutes' walk away.
The nearest rail stations are Cardiff Central Rail Station (Train, about 6 minutes' walk away), Cardiff Queen Street Rail Station (Train, about 8 minutes' walk away). There are also 119 bus stops within walking distance.
